The initial impetus that was received from these kings and queens was required for the religious structures to attain strength after which it could fashion itself into a self-sustaining entity. A promotion of these religions also served important functions for these monarchs as it led to unity in realms other than religion in most cases. This effect was partially due to the emergence of alternative centres of power but it was also because of the individual philosophies that were a part of these religions.

These philosophies may not have survived in the absence of the state sponsorship that it received but since the monarchs of this age extended their patronage to these religions, there was a certain kind of unity that was forced upon the people as a result of the royal patronage. Buddhism managed to create a certain kind of unity between sections of Hinduism, which was till then the main religion of the Indian subcontinent. The different philosophical views that existed in Hinduism became united owing to the fact that Buddhism was on the ascendant due to the patronage that was extended to it during the reign of Asoka, who reigned over India.

Buddhism represented a challenge to traditional ideas of Hinduism which advocated the existence of the caste system and had many rituals that were present for the sake of upholding the structure of caste. With more egalitarian structures, Buddhism held great attractions for the downtrodden of the Hindu society. If not for the patronage extended by Asoka, Buddhism may not have survived the opposition from Hindu power structures. Asoka’s patronage, however, enabled there to be unity in the political realm.
